I have a 1996 LT1 Automatic, I am removing the cats when installing these headers. I need to know though, when you order them, do you NEED the Y pipe that they provide? Do they provide it for all the years? I mean could I get it cheaper without this piping? I have a b&B triflow Y pipe already I think and wouldn't want to change it.

Default Re: TPIS Header Owners (Black96Corvette)

You do not need nor want the y-pipe, this was for L98s who used one primary cat. The y-pipe from TPIS is a $75 option, we went all through this headache when we did the group purchase a couple of months ago. Call up Chris at Eastcoast Supercharging, he had the best deals going on the TPIS headers and can awnser any other questions you may have for your application. :chevy
